OGDENSBURG -- Claxton-Hepburn Medical Center will provide a free hernia seminar and screening June 20, from 2-5 p.m., in its first floor outpatient surgical unit.
Dr. Michael Oakley and Dr. Noah Zuker, Claxton-Hepburn’s robotic surgeons, will provide a brief presentation on hernias and the importance of screening.
Immediately following the presentation, participants will have an opportunity for a free hernia screening.
Three separate presentations will take place on the top of each hour.
Registration is required by calling the medical center’s community relations department at 315-713-5251.
